CANADA: USDCAD Reverses ADP Pop As BoC Decision Comes Into Focus

Jul-07 14:44
  • USDCAD sees new session lows of 1.329, with CAD FI seeing sizeable underperformance to Tsys post respective jobs reports and WTI reversing earlier losses.
  • Broader USD weakness does however limit CAD on the day vs other crosses, with CAD only outperforming USD and much less so EUR.
  • The move sees the pair swing back from an earlier testing of 1.3386 (50% retrace of the May 26-Jun 27 downleg) and closes in on yesterday’s low of 1.3275 that in turn probed support at the 20-day EMA of 1.3280.
  • A further push lower would next open a key short-term level of 1.3203 (Jul 4 low) although Wednesday’s BoC decision looming could possibly limit further moves.

CROSS ASSET: Sizeable Sell Programs Accompany Pullback in Equity Indices

Jun-07 14:42
  • Reversal off highs for equity markets prompting a catch-up bid in the USD in recent trade, helping drag the likes of EUR/USD and GBP/USD well off the earlier highs.
  • Biggest sell programs of the day so far (and bigger than any seen yesterday) going through via the NYSE TICK Index, with near 850 names sold - adding weight in the index to put the e-mini S&P at fresh lows. More sizeable volumes crossed in equity futures at 1035ET/1535BST - helping trigger the weakness in stocks.
  • Equity drop doing little to turn around yields, however, with the 10y yield pushing to fresh highs of 3.7545% and getting a tailwind from the hawkish interpretation for the BOC. A 3.76% print would be the highest of the week so far.
